Is there a way to set them as hidden from all previous layouts/detail views except the new layout/detail view?
-
Maybe the easiest way to do this is to create the dimension on the layout.
If you use osnaps, then the dimtext will reflect model distances. -
Another option you have is to make a layer, let’s call it Dimlayout-2.
You can turn it off in the Details in the current Layout or All layouts.
This option on the menu that you will see when you right-click of the Detail On button (light bulb) in the Layer panel when the details is active.
Then pick "Layer On in this details only → All Layouts.
Now moving forward in the model you can also set New Detail On to “Off”.
Now when you make a new detail, this layer will always be Off in a new detail on any layout , but can always be turned on if required.
